“1. Coordinate all activities in the unit 2. Identify user needs and system functionality and ensuring that ICT facilities meet these needs; 3. Planning, budgeting, developing and implementing the ICT action plan, 4. To design and implement the CHU strategy for development of information systems and technology 5. Maintaining and developing a modern, cost effective, stable and secure ICT infrastructure available 24 hours. 6. Scheduling upgrades and security backups of hardware and software systems; 7. Setting up and monitoring contracts with external suppliers for the provision of technical support as required; 8. Developing, in liaison with HR, a formalized training programme for all users with the aim of raising skills, standards and awareness in the use of ICT applications 9. Ensuring that software licensing laws are adhered to; 10. Providing secure access to the network for remote users; 11. To ensure capacity building by planning and finding trainings for end users and ICT staff 12. To ensure relation with external ICT companies 13. To establish the ICT monthly, semester and annual reports and submit it to head of departments 14. To ensure that CHU web site and other web based communication platform are well managed 15. To ensure effective support in all department in ICT issues 16. To ensure the integrity, security and confidentiality of data kept in department 17. Ensure continuous improvement of the institution performance standards to achieve planed goals and objectives 18. Submit monthly, quarterly and annually report to the supervisor 19. Perform other related duties as required ” NB. With one (1) or Three (3) year of relevant working experience in System Administrator.
